The main methods of rehabilitation training for the hemiplegic side of the arm in cerebral infarction patients include the following: 1. Patients are encouraged to lie on the affected side as much as possible, and the affected arm can be placed on a small pillow, taking care not to be pressed. 2. The shoulder, elbow and wrist joints can be moved passively at least twice a day for at least 15 minutes each time. The joint mobility is kept at about 10° less than the normal mobility. 3. Progressive impedance training and isometric muscle training are performed for the affected arm muscles. 4. Functional electrical stimulation therapy and myoelectric biofeedback therapy can be performed for the arm muscles to improve the muscle strength and function of the paralyzed arm. 5. In addition, the function of the affected arm can be restored by means of Tui Na, massage, acupuncture and physiotherapy. 6, If the patient has muscle stiffness and tonicity in the arm, ethylparisone, baclofen and local intramuscular injection of botulinum toxin can be given to release muscle spasm.
